    A study to assess changes in myocardial perfusion after treatment with spinal cord stimulation and percutaneous myocardial laser revascularisation; data from a randomised trial

    <p>Abstract</p> <p>Background</p> <p>Spinal cord stimulation (SCS) and percutaneous myocardial laser revascularisation (PMR) are treatment modalities used to treat refractory angina pectoris, with the major aim of such treatment being the relief of disabling symptoms. This study compared the change in myocardial perfusion following SCS and PMR treatment.</p> <p>Methods</p> <p>Subjects with Canadian Cardiovascular Society class 3/4 angina and reversible perfusion defects as assessed by single-photon emission computed tomographic myocardial perfusion scintigraphy were randomised to SCS (34) or PMR (34). 28 subjects in each group underwent repeat myocardial perfusion imaging 12 months post intervention. Visual scoring of perfusion images was performed using a 20-segment model and a scale of 0 to 4.</p> <p>Results</p> <p>The mean (standard deviation) baseline summed rest score (SRS) and stress scores (SSS) were 4.6 (5.7) and 13.6 (9.0) in the PMR group and 6.1 (7.4) and 16.8 (11.6) in the SCS group. At 12 months, SRS was 5.5 (6.0) and SSS 15.3 (11.3) in the PMR group and 6.9 (8.2) and 15.1 (10.9) in the SCS group. There was no significant difference between the two treatment groups adjusted for baseline (p = 1.0 for SRS, p = 0.29 for SSS).</p> <p>Conclusion</p> <p>There was no significant difference in myocardial perfusion one year post treatment with SCS or PMR.</p

    Vaginal Dysbiosis and Partial Bacterial Vaginosis: The Interpretation of the "Grey Zones" of Clinical Practice

    Bacterial vaginosis (BV) affects one-third of reproductive age women, increasing the risk of acquiring sexually transmitted infections (STIs) and posing a risk for reproductive health. The current diagnosis with Gram stain (Nugent Score) identifies a transitional stage named partial BV or intermediate microbiota, raising the problem of how to clinically handle it. We retrospectively analyzed cervicovaginal swabs from 985 immunocompetent non-pregnant symptomaticspp. women (vaginal discharge, burning, itching) by Nugent score and qPCR for BV, aerobic or fungal vaginitis, and STIs (Mycoplasmas spp., Chlamydia t., Trichomonas v., and Neisseria g.). Nugent scores 0-3 and 7-10 were confirmed in 99.3% and 89.7% cases, respectively, by qPCR. Among Nugent scores 4-6 (partial BV), qPCR identified 46.1% of BV cases, with 37.3% of cases negative for BV, and only 16.7% of partial BV. Gram staining and qPCR were discordant (p value = 0.0001) mainly in the partial BV. Among the qPCR BV cases, the presence of aerobic vaginitis and STIs was identified, with a significant association (p < 0.0001) between the STIs and partial BV/overt BV. qPCR is more informative and accurate, and its use as an alternative or in combination with Gram staining could help clinicians in having an overview of the complex vaginal microbiota and in the interpretation of partial BV that can correspond to vaginitis and/or STIs

    Vaginal microbiota dysmicrobism and role of biofilm-forming bacteria

    Bacterial vaginosis involves the presence of a polymicrobial biofilm on the vaginal epithelium, guaranteeing immune escape and spread of antibiotic resistance. To spot known biofilm-forming bacteria, we profiled the vaginal microbiome of sixty-four symptomatic women suffering from a different grade of vaginal disorders and sixty asymptomatic healthy women. Specific microbial profiles distinguished symptomatic from asymptomatic women and characterized the grade of dysmicrobism within the symptomatic group. Lactobacillus crispatus and iners predominated on the healthy vaginal mucosa, while Lactobacillus gasseri predominated in the intermediate dysmicrobism. Furthermore, the intermediate grade of dysmicrobism was characterized by other lactic acid-producers species than Lactobacilli, able to rescue the microbial imbalance, and Ureaplasma parvum-serovar 3. The vaginosis group exhibited the overgrowth of Prevotella bivia, which is known to enhance the biofilm formation by Gardnerella vaginalis, and the presence of Streptococcus anginosus, which is emerging as a new cooperating player of the vaginal biofilm. Identifying specific microorganisms promoting or preventing the biofilm formation could increase the accuracy for a better definition of the vaginal dysmicrobism concept and therapeutic intervention

    Neisseria gonorrhoeae ciprofloxacin-resistant strains were associated with Chlamydia trachomatis coinfection

    Aim: This study aims to characterize circulating strains to predict their relationship with sexually transmitted microorganisms, Chlamydia trachomatis, HIV, HCV, Treponema pallidum, HPV, Mycoplasmas, in an Italian multiethnic area, which has revealed a recent increase of Neisseria gonorrhoeae first-line antibiotic resistance. Materials & methods: We performed N. gonorrhoeae multiantigen sequence typing and the N. gonorrhoeae sequence typing for antimicrobial resistance. Results: We identified mutations in genes conferring resistance to cephalosporins, macrolides, fluoroquinolones through por and tbpB loci, and we reported new combinations of already known alleles. N. gonorrhoeae resistance to ciprofloxacin was associated with C. trachomatis coinfection. Conclusion: This study's data proved the utility of a routine N. gonorrhoeae molecular characterization to monitor the evolution of antibiotic resistance and to detect the most effective clinical treatment

    The additive prognostic value of perfusion and functional data assessed by quantitative gated SPECT in women

    Background: The aim of this study was to assess the prognostic value of technetium-99m tetrofosmin gated SPECT imaging in women using quantitative gated single photon emission computed tomography (SPECT) imaging. Methods: We followed 453 consecutive female patients. Average follow-up was 1.33 years (max. 2.55). Hard endpoints were cardiac death, acute myocardial infarction, or documented ventricular fibrillation. Event-free survival curves were obtained. Optimal cutoff values for left ventricular (LV) volumes, LV ejection fraction (LVEF), and perfusion data to predict outcome were determined by ROC curve analysis. Results: A total of 236 patients had an abnormal study, of whom 27 patients experienced hard events (16 deaths) and 47 patients soft events. For hard events summed stress score (SSS) and LVEF, and for any cardiac event SSS showed independent incremental prognostic value. The survival curves were maximally separated when using cutoff values for SSS of ≥ 22 and LVEF < 52% (P < 0.001, HR 4.61 and P < 0.001 HR 5.24 for SSS and LVEF resp.), and SSS ≥ 14 (P < 0.001 HR 3.76) for any cardiac event. Conclusion: In women, perfusion and functional parameters derived from quantitative gated technetium-99m tetrofosmin SPECT imaging can adequately be used for cardiac risk assessment. Using quantitative gated SPECT, female patients with an LVEF < 52% or an SSS ≥ 22 are at increased risk for subsequent hard events. Furthermore, patients with an SSS ≥ 14 are at increased risk for any cardiac events
